Here is how I did it: Teach the basic commands of backing up, going forward, and moving off left and right from the ground. After that, I started by tapping him on the chest while holding the lead rope so he couldn’t back up. Not knowing what I wanted, he tried moving off left and right, but I blocked his forward motion with the stick and then kept tapping. cont. . .
Eventually, once he tried back, forward, left and right without success, he tried up, and I rewarded him with release (stopped tapping) and a cookie, and then repeat. You do have to be careful though and make sure that you reward not rearing as well, or you may end up with a horse that rears to get a cookie when you are asking for it. Hope this helps.
